Constellation
Payments companies reported to CMS as associated with Constellation. "Associated with" is CMS's wording: it links a payment to a product without saying the money was spent on it.

Clinicians most associated with Constellation
These are the largest totals companies reported as associated with Constellation. They are typically speaking or consulting arrangements, which companies must report by law; appearing here is not evidence of anything improper.
